David Archuleta To Sing Like Steve Wonder On American Idol

by Paul Cashmere - March 11 2008

American Idol one-to-watch David Archuleta will do a Beatles song on this week's show but he won't be using their arrangement. Instead, Archuleta will cover the McCartney classic the way his hero Stevie Wonder recorded it.

David will perform 'We Can World It Out'.

Although the song was first written and recorded by The Beatles, Stevie Wonder had a major hit with a rhythm 'n' blues version of song when in the 70s.

Archuleta is the one they expect will win this year's show. His talent is well above the other finalists.

David cites Wonder as one of his influences, along with Natalie Cole, Kirk Franklin and Bryan Adams.

'We Can Work It Out' by Archuleta will come complete with a string section.

Archuleta is from Murray, Utah but auditioned for the show in San Diego.
